This inspiring performance on December 14, 2002 features the acclaimed Upper Galilee Choir and Ranaana Symphonette Orchestra performing Handel’s MESSIAH at Tabgha, the traditional site of Jesus Christ’s miracle of feeding the five thousand along the Sea of Galilee. The concert was executive produced by Doug Coppi, CEO of Curtain Call Productions and recorded in the Church of the Multiplication of Loaves and Fish. The audio was originally recorded in 24 Bit Surround Sound for DVD release but is available here in standard 16 bit two-track stereo. The music was recorded and mixed under the direction of New York City-based music producer, John McCracken (producer of Michael Crawford’s R.I.A.A. certified Gold record, On Eagle’s Wings on Atlantic Records) and Sony Music Studios senior recording engineer, Richard King (5-time Grammy winner and 2004 winner for Yo Yo Ma's Obrigado Brazil on Sony Music.)
